CVE-2026-77124
In affected versions of Nexus Repository 3, the script execution endpoint (POST /service/rest/v1/script/{name}/run) did not verify whether script execution had been administratively disabled. An account holding script-execution permission could continue to run previously-created scripts even after an administrator set nexus.scripts.allowCreation=false, undermining the expectation that this setting fully blocks script execution.
